About TEWAN

Tourism Entrepreneurs Women Association Nepal (TEWAN) is an organization founded by women in businesses of Pokhara, with a motive of “Equal Participation in Sustainable Tourism”.

This organization is a non-profitable public social organization that operates various social services as campaign with the involvement of various government, non-government organizations associated with the tourism field.

TEWAN aims to group all active female entrepreneurs involved in the tourism business and help institutionalize gender equality and women empowerment for development of tourism. Through various training programs that will help provide quality service in tourism business, we wish to increase the involvement of women in Tourism.
